How much does it cost to rent a home in Decatur Heights?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Decatur Heights 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,994 | $1,200 | $3,250 |
Decatur Heights 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,908 | $1,560 | $6,000 |
Decatur Heights 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,217 | $1,700 | $5,400 |
Decatur Heights 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,483 | $3,200 | $6,250 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Decatur Heights
What type of rentals are currently available in Decatur Heights?
There are currently 151 Apartments for Rent in Decatur Heights, GA with pricing that ranges from $758 to $8,335. There are also 111 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Decatur Heights ranging from $700 to $6,250.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Decatur Heights?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Decatur Heights ranges from $700 to $6,250 with an average monthly rent of $2,568.
